Tips for Choosing Casinos with the Best User Interfaces
How can you tell which live casinos offer the smoothest interfaces before committing your money? Here are some practical tips I’ve found helpful over the years:
- Explore demo versions or free-play modes to get a feel for navigation and responsiveness.
- Check for mobile compatibility—how well does the interface adapt to your smartphone or tablet?
- Look for clearly labeled buttons and minimal clutter, which make gameplay more straightforward.
- Read player feedback focusing on technical issues or user experience.
- Consider the variety of payment methods offered, since a smooth cashier interface is part of the overall experience.
These steps can save you from investing time and money into platforms that might look appealing but fall short in everyday use. Remember, a quality interface supports responsible gaming by allowing players to set limits and access support easily.
Integrating Security and Fairness into User Experience
Beyond aesthetics and speed, the best live casinos ensure their interfaces uphold security and fairness standards. Features like SSL encryption protect your personal and financial data, while trusted gaming regulators supervise the fairness of games, often reflected in the transparent display of RTP rates.
Providers such as Evolution and Pragmatic Play continuously update their software to maintain compliance and protect against potential vulnerabilities. This commitment to safety is often visible in the user interface, with clear access to terms, responsible gaming tools, and licensing information.
Ultimately, a smooth interface that also communicates trustworthiness helps players relax and enjoy the game without second-guessing the integrity of the platform.
